Ideologies quickly become religions to their followers, at which point the solutions proposed by such ideologies can no longer be challenged
Media companies in the past had to actually balance neutrality and accuracy or they would lose their viewership to their competitors
How you arrived at what you think is more important than what you think
It is optimal to create a culture where no idea is sacred so each idea can be properly scrutinized
Criticism culture attacks the idea while cancel culture attacks the person
The media is not penalized for lying; corporate media journalists are incentivized to lie because they are rewarded with clicks and not held accountable by their team for lying
If you approach a complex issue with nuance, you will likely be attacked by both sides of the low-rung thinking political spectrum
